This south London group with Yorkshire roots, purveys a similar brand of sardonic, moody post-punk to that favored by many U.K. guitar acts who sprang forth in the late 2010s and early 2020s.
Zac Lawrence (vocals), Alfie Husband (drums) and George Ullyott (bass), were each born in the late '90s and raised in three different Yorkshire towns. They collaborated as teenagers in the local punk act, Mice on Mars, before upping sticks to London in August 2017.
